C.O.D.
Title: C.O.D.
Character: Don
Released: July 3, 1981
Type: Movie
Albert Zack is a struggling, bumbling, advertising salesman hired to save the Beaver Bra Company from impending doom. He is charged with signing five specific, world-famous, busty woman as endorsers for the bra line. Silly antics and situations occur as he tries, mostly in various costumes, to get close enough to these women to make his pitch for their signature. Working against him are two board members who stand to gain if the company fails. As he circles the globe in search of these signatures, he is faced with a variety of challenges, one of which is a relationship with his own secretary.

Fat Angels
Title: Fat Angels
Released: February 27, 1981
Type: Movie
An overweight man and woman become penpals but are too embarrassed to send each other photographs of themselves and instead exchange pictures of two thinner people. Comedic complications arise when the two penpals finally arrange to meet in person.

Lady Liberty
Title: Lady Liberty
Character: Steward (uncredited)
Released: December 22, 1971
Type: Movie
The story concerns the difficulties and reactions of Maddalena (Sophia Loren), an Italian visitor to New York City. She has come to the country carrying a huge mortadella sausage which she intends as a gift for her fiancé. But Customs do not allow processed meat to enter the U.S., so she is held at JFK airport...
